FUTAKO TAMAGAWA is a small but well-to-do residential enclave in Tokyo's Setagaya ward (not far from St. Mary's International School). An express stop on both the Oimachi and Denentoshi train lines the outdoor, elevated platform at Futako Tamagawa station overflows with commuters during the morning and evening rush. On weekends and holidays, high school and college kids, young couples, and families throng to the Futako shopping center, dominated by a branch of Takashimaya department store. The chic boutiques on the ground floor have something of a Rodeo Drive feel to them, and the food hall is fabulous.

Elegantly prepared take-out foods, edible gifts, traditional pantry items made with artisan care, and organic produce rival for your attention.

You may want to stay on after the tour concludes to have afternoon tea at one of the many eat-in corners and restaurant counters in the foodhall. Dinner options include wonderful restaurants in the Takashimaya complex and immediate neighborhood.
